Coastal Sand Dunes are the first line of defense against cylcones and storm tides. They act as buffers to absorb the impact of the destructive forces of an angry ocean, slowing down the possibility of flooding and damage.  Whilst the dune areas of Holloways Beach are not so big in size, they are still very important to maintain due to the high population within the area, as well as the heavy presence of wildlife and native plants in the region, all of which can be heavily impacted by storms on the coast!

To remain stabilized, these dunes and edges of our beaches need to have healthy vegetation present. Groundcovers and vines such as our native Morning Glory work well to cover these dunes, preventing excess sand being washed away and preventing erosion.
These areas, however, as prone to invasive species, as seeds easily wash up on shore in the tide, carried from nearby areas, and start to manifest along beach front areas, taking over native vegetation.

We will be working in partnership with long running local community group Holloways Beach Coast Care to begin removing some common invasive species that have taken over the ridgeline from the front of the local Environment Education Centre, further up the coast where it escapes into coastal woodland. There are beautiful views to admire in the morning as we take on these pests on direct beach front.
It is also a great opportunity to learn about common pest plants within the region, many of which can begin in people’s backyards.
The species we will be focusing on this morning will be Singapore Daisy and Mother in Law Tongue.
